主题
备份与恢复
在完成性能优化后,下一步是 掌握 Gentoo 系统的备份与恢复方法,确保数据和系统配置安全。
一、备份策略
- 配置文件备份
- 定期备份
/etc/portage/make.conf、/etc/portage/package.*等重要配置 - 可使用
tar或rsync:
bash
tar czvf /backup/portage-config-$(date +%F).tar.gz /etc/portage- 用户数据备份
- 备份
/home目录或关键工作目录:
bash
rsync -av --progress /home/ /backup/home/- 系统镜像备份(可选)
- 使用
dd或 LVM 快照创建整盘备份 - 适合系统崩溃或硬盘故障恢复
二、恢复方法
- 恢复配置文件
bash
tar xzvf portage-config-YYYY-MM-DD.tar.gz -C /- 恢复用户数据
bash
rsync -av --progress /backup/home/ /home/- 系统镜像恢复
- 使用
dd或 LVM 快照恢复整个系统 - 确保目标分区大小与原系统一致
三、定期备份实践
- 建议建立定期备份计划(cron):
bash
crontab -e
# 每周日凌晨 2 点备份 /home
0 2 * * 0 rsync -av /home/ /backup/home/- 保留多个历史备份版本,防止误删除或损坏
四、建议操作
- 核心系统文件与用户数据分开备份
- 重要配置文件和世界集列表定期快照
- 在升级内核或系统前进行完整备份,降低风险